He got a mil more in base salary for the next three years out of the deal. Fans always get worked up over saying players were doing the team a favor or some shit. Baltimore fans this offseason were calling Suggs a selfless team player hero for "helping us" clear cap room...because we turned $3mil of his salary into a bonus. So the team went to him and said "hey, you know that base salary you were going to have to earn over the course of the season? we're just going to give you most of it up front right now in a big check!" What player would say no? "Nah, I'm good, I wanted to wait and see if I get hurt first! Fuck yo cap!"
